Add PSS algorithm printing. This is an initial step towards full PSS support.
Uses ASN1 module in Martin Kaiser's PSS patch.

+static int rsa_pss_param_print(BIO *bp, RSASSA_PSS_PARAMS *pss, int indent)
+ {
+ int rv = 0;
+ X509_ALGOR *maskHash = NULL;
+ if (!pss)
+ {
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, " (INVALID PSS PARAMETERS)\n") <= 0)
+ return 0;
+ }
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"\n")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(!BIO_indent(bp, indent, 128))
+ goto err;
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"Hash Algorithm: ")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+
+ if (pss->hashAlgorithm)
+ {
+ if (i2a_ASN1_OBJECT(bp, pss->hashAlgorithm->algorithm) <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 }
+ else if (BIO_puts(bp, "sha1 (default)")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"\n")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+
+ if (!BIO_indent(bp, indent, 128))
+ goto err;
+
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"Mask Algorithm: ")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(pss->maskGenAlgorithm)
+ {
+ ASN1_TYPE *param = pss->maskGenAlgorithm->parameter;
+ if (param->type == V_ASN1_SEQUENCE)
+ {
+ const unsigned char *p = param->value.sequence->data;
+ int plen = param->value.sequence->length;
+ maskHash = d2i_X509_ALGOR(NULL, &p, plen);
+ }
+ if (i2a_ASN1_OBJECT(bp, pss->maskGenAlgorithm->algorithm) <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, " with ")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(i2a_ASN1_OBJECT(bp, maskHash->algorithm) <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 }
+ else if (BIO_puts(bp, "mgf1 with sha1 (default)")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 BIO_puts(bp, "\n");
+
+ if (!BIO_indent(bp, indent, 128))
+ goto err;
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"Salt Length: ")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(pss->saltLength)
+ {
+ if (i2a_ASN1_INTEGER(bp, pss->saltLength) <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 }
+ else if (BIO_puts(bp, "20 (default)")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 BIO_puts(bp, "\n");
+
+ if (!BIO_indent(bp, indent, 128))
+ goto err;
+ if (BIO_puts(bp, "Trailer Field: ")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 if (pss->trailerField)
+ {
+ if (i2a_ASN1_INTEGER(bp, pss->trailerField) <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 }
+ else if (BIO_puts(bp, "0xbc (default)") <= 0)
+ goto err;
+ BIO_puts(bp, "\n");
+
+ rv = 1;
+
+ err:
+ if (maskHash)
+ X509_ALGOR_free(maskHash);
+ RSASSA_PSS_PARAMS_free(pss);
+ return rv;
+
+ }
+
+static int rsa_sig_print(BIO *bp, const X509_ALGOR *sigalg,
+ const ASN1_STRING *sig,
+ int indent, ASN1_PCTX *pctx)
+ {
+ if (OBJ_obj2nid(sigalg->algorithm) == NID_rsassaPss)
+ {
+ RSASSA_PSS_PARAMS *pss = NULL;
+ ASN1_TYPE *param = sigalg->parameter;
+ if (param && param->type == V_ASN1_SEQUENCE)
+ {
+ const unsigned char *p = param->value.sequence->data;
+ int plen = param->value.sequence->length;
+ pss = d2i_RSASSA_PSS_PARAMS(NULL, &p, plen);
+ }
+ if (!rsa_pss_param_print(bp, pss, indent))
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 return X509_signature_dump(bp, sig, indent);
+ }
